Broadway Family Easter Egg Bake

Broadway Family Easter Egg Bake
Broadway Family Easter Egg Bake requires about 1 hour and 35 minutes from start to finish. This hor d'oeuvre has 165 calories, 9g of protein, and 10g of fat per serving. This recipe serves 15.
